Exploring the intersection of Python and Machine Learning: Current trends and future possibilities
Ali Majnoon
Developer (Web Scraping | Data Science | Energy System| Blogger | Self Publish Author | AI | ML | Computer Programmer & Google IT support)
Exploring the intersection of Python and Machine Learning: Current trends and future possibilities
Abstract
The article discusses the intersection of Python and machine learning, including current trends and prospects. It mentions that Python is a popular choice for data science and machine learning tasks due to its flexibility, readability, and ease of use. The article highlights deep learning and reinforcement learning as current trends in the field. It mentions that Python has many libraries and frameworks that make it easy to develop and train models for these techniques. The article also suggests that future advancements in machine learning could include machine learning in the Internet of Things (IoT), natural language processing (NLP), and generative models. Overall, the article suggests that Python and machine learning are becoming increasingly intertwined and that we can expect to see more advancements in this field in the future.
Keywords: "Python," "machine learning," "deep learning," "reinforcement learning," "Internet of Things," "natural language processing," "generative models," "data science."
Python and machine learning have become intertwined in recent years, as Python has become one of the most popular programming languages for data science and machine learning tasks. Python's flexibility, readability, and ease of use make it an ideal choice for these tasks. In this article, we will explore the current trends in the intersection of Python and machine learning and discuss some of the future possibilities.
One of the biggest trends in machine learning is deep understanding. Python has become a popular choice for developing deep learning models due to the wide range of available libraries and frameworks, such as TensorFlow and Keras. These libraries make it easy to build and train deep neural networks, which are very effective in tasks such as image recognition, natural language processing, and speech recognition. With deep learning, we can achieve state-of-the-art performance in many jobs, such as image classification, object detection, and natural language understanding. The ease of use of these libraries and the flexibility that Python provides make it an excellent choice for deep learning.
Another trend in machine learning is the use of reinforcement learning. This technique, inspired by how animals learn, has been used to train agents to perform a wide range of tasks, such as playing video games and controlling robots. Python has become a popular choice for developing reinforcement learning systems due to the availability of libraries such as OpenAI Gym and stable baselines. These libraries provide a simple, easy-to-use interface for creating and training reinforcement learning agents. Reinforcement learning has been used to train agents to perform various tasks such as playing Go and chess, controlling robots, and even trading stocks.
领英推荐
In the future, we can expect to see even more advancements in the field of machine learning. One area that has the potential to make a significant impact is the use of machine learning in the Internet of Things (IoT). With the increasing number of devices connected to the internet, we can expect to see a massive amount of data generated by these devices. Who can use Python to analyze this data and extract valuable insights, which who can use to improve the performance of these devices? For example, using machine learning algorithms, we can predict the maintenance needs of industrial equipment, optimize the performance of intelligent buildings and even predict equipment failure before it happens.
Another area where machine learning can have a significant impact is natural language processing (NLP). Python has a wide range of libraries and frameworks for NLP, such as NLTK and spaCy, which make it easy to work with text data. In the future, we can expect to see more sophisticated NLP systems that can understand the meaning of the text and respond to it in a human-like way. With the increasing amount of text data being generated, NLP has become an essential area of research. With Python, we can efficiently train models to perform sentiment analysis, text classification, and even machine translation tasks.
Another area where Python and machine learning can have an impact is in the field of generative models. Generative models such as GANs (Generative Adversarial Networks) and VAEs (Variational Autoencoders) have generated images, videos, and text. Python has a wide range of libraries and frameworks for generative models, such as PyTorch, TensorFlow, and Keras, which make it easy to train and use these models. In the future, we can expect to see more and more applications of generative models, such as creating realistic virtual environments for autonomous training agents, generating authentic images for movies and video games, and even creating new drugs.
In conclusion, Python and machine learning have become inseparable. The ease of use, flexibility and wide range of available libraries and frameworks make Python popular for machine learning tasks. As machine learning continues to evolve, we can expect even more advancements made possible by using Python.
It is important to note that Python is a popular choice for machine learning and data visualization, cleaning, and analysis. This makes Python an excellent choice for end-to-end data science projects. With libraries such as Pandas, NumPy, and Matplotlib, Python makes it easy to work with and visualize data.
In terms of future possibilities, we also expect to see more and more machine learning applications in healthcare, finance, and autonomous systems. The ability to analyze large amounts of data and make predictions has the potential to revolutionize many industries. Additionally, the advancement of edge computing and distributed computing has enabled machine learning models to be deployed on low-power devices and at the edge of the network, which opens up new possibilities for applications in areas such as robotics and autonomous vehicles.
In summary, the intersection of Python and machine learning is a constantly evolving field with many possibilities. The ease of use, flexibility, and wide range of libraries and frameworks make Python an ideal choice for machine learning tasks. We can expect to see future advancements in deep learning, reinforcement learning, the internet of things, natural language processing, and generative models. The ability to analyze large amounts of data and make predictions has the potential to revolutionize many industries.
Painter, Illustrator & Pattern Designer
1 年You are so professional that is a pleasure to work with you